Description
Discover the musical versatility and precision of the Yamaha 281S, a student flute that seamlessly bridges the gap between beginner ease and professional quality. Designed for aspiring flutists, this model offers a pristine playing experience with its silver-plated finish that ensures durability and a sleek aesthetic. The CY headjoint is a standout feature, engineered to produce a rich and focused tone, making it easier for players to achieve a beautiful sound across all octaves.
The Yamaha 281S is crafted with closed-hole keys, providing an intuitive and comfortable grip for developing musicians. Its offset-G key design accommodates smaller hands, promoting a natural hand position that is crucial for long practice sessions. The flute's split E mechanism is another notable attribute, enhancing the instrument's response and facilitating the execution of high E notes with greater ease.
Yamaha's commitment to quality is evident in the design of the 281S, ensuring that each instrument is rigorously tested to meet the high standards expected by both educators and performers. This flute is an excellent choice for students ready to elevate their skills and explore the full potential of their musical journey.

Features and functionality
-
The first digit in Yamaha flute models indicates the level: 2 for student, 3 or 4 for intermediate upgrades with more silver, 5-7 for professional lines.
Source -
The second digit in Yamaha models designates key types: 2 for closed holes, 6 for open holes, 8 for inline G keys.
Source -
The presence of an "H" in Yamaha model numbers indicates a B footjoint, extending the range to low B, useful for specific sheet music requirements.
